Embodiment 3

[0067]A garden arbor and shrub plant in Xinjian Park, Suzhou was used for acceptance, and the method of the present invention and the existing manual method were used for comparison. Based on 100 trees and 500 shrubs, three measurements were carried out. For plant identification, the method of the present invention is consistent for three identifications, and after rechecking, all are correct. In the existing manual identification, the three results are different, and there is an error of about 15%. For the overlapping part, after rechecking, the correct rate is 89%; for the characteristic parameters, this The inventive method has a high degree of approximation for three-time recognition, and the error is less than 3%. In the existing manual measurement, there is an error of about 7% to 10% in the three-time results.

Abstract

The invention aims to provide a construction acceptance method for a tree and shrub plant specification in landscaping engineering. By use of the method, through the photographing and camera shootingfunction of a mobile phone, on the basis of photo identification, a ranging function is realized, so that a user quickly obtains the type and the relevant size of a plant, and a construction drawing is compared to finish the construction acceptance work of the plant specification. By use of the method, the problem of huge price differences due to inconvenient data measurement in the existing plantconstruction acceptance is solved, and in addition, the professional requirements of users can be lowered through photographing identification and comparison functions.
